## Formula sandbox tuning

User-supplied formulas in Gridmoor execute inside a restricted interpreter with hard ceilings on time, memory, and call depth. Reviewers should confirm any change to these ceilings is justified in the PR description, since raising them widens the abuse surface. Defaults were chosen from production traces. The current limits are as follows.

limits module of tafog-fawip:
WEIGHTS = {
    "julix": 57,
    "lamys": 992,
    "kasvan": 209,
    "quenok": 750,
    "alddor": 259,
    "oliath": 1009,
    "wenix": 815,
}

**Meeting Notes — Audit-Log Viewer (Lanternview)**

Discussed the support team's request for filtered exports. Agreed: the viewer will add per-tenant date-range filters next sprint, and redacted fields will stay hidden in exports. Known issue with slow queries past 90 days remains open; workaround is the archive lookup tool. Support should route all viewer escalations to the engineer listed below.

account owner for bawip-tahag: Raleth Quenok

## Step 3: Apply cache fixes from the Pinefort postmortem

The stale-cache bug came from mismatched TTLs between the edge layer and the Pinefort origin. Do not copy old config forward. Set the invalidation hook before enabling the new cache tier, verify in staging, then promote. Future changes to TTLs must update both layers in one commit. Apply the following values.

settings of tagef-bawif:
DRUIX_HOST=druix.zemvarlabs.internal
DRUIX_PORT=8000

Ticket: Staging env misconfigured for Siftgate bloom filter

The bloom layer in front of the Pellet KV store is rejecting all lookups in staging because the env file was copied from the dev template without credentials. False-positive tuning values are fine; only the auth line is missing. To unblock the weekly demo, the Pellet admission secret must be set on the following line.

env line for yaguf-fajop: LEDGER_TOKEN13=fb08984397349